Piddletrenthide 2016T802. Copper alloy coin of Carus cleaned for ID, March 2017. Ob IMP CARVS PF AVG. Rv SPES REPUBLICA. Possible mintmark SXXI in exergue. Coin from Layer 4, Coin Group 7, as excavated from the pot by Marisa Kalvins.

English: <a href="http://data.ordnancesurvey.co.uk/doc/7000000000014491">Piddletrenthide</a>, Dorset

A hoard of 2114 third century radiate coins in an incomplete pottery vessel to AD 296.

Summary:

<tbody> </tbody> <tbody> </tbody>

Reign

Total

Gallienus (joint reign, AD 253-60)

5

Salonina (joint)

1

Saloninus Caesar

2

Gallienus (sole), AD 260-8

103

Salonina (sole)

9

Claudius II, AD 268-70

105

Divus Claudius II, AD 270

14

Quintillus, AD 270

7

Aurelian, AD 270-5

102

Severina

13

Tacitus, AD 275-6

379

Florian, AD 276

20

Probus, AD 276-82

624

Carus, AD 282-3

4

Divus Carus

1

Carinus Caesar

2

Carinus Augustus, AD 283-5

1

Numerian Caesar

1

Numerian, AD 283-4

5

Diocletian, AD 284-93

14

Maximian, AD 285-93

5

Postumus, AD 260-8

3

Postumus (debased), AD 268-9

10

Marius, AD 269

5

Victorinus, AD 269-71

181

Divus Victorinus

2

Tetricus I, AD 271-4

316

Tetricus II

106

Uncertain Gallic

1

Carausius (AD 286-93)

12

Allectus (AD 293-6)

2

illegible

4

Irregular (barbarous)

55

Total

2114

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
